Supercharged Savings: Exploring the Pros and Cons of SMSFs

Are you thrilled to take command of your retirement savings? An SMSF, or Self-Managed Super Fund, could be your key to success. These funds offer a level of autonomy that traditional superannuation options simply can't match. You become the manager, deciding how your funds are utilized to achieve your retirement dreams. On the other hand, SMSFs come with their own set of responsibilities. You'll need to master complex guidelines, keep meticulous logs, and ensure your fund remains compliant.

Self-Managed Super Funds (SMSFs): Are the Benefits Worth the Effort?

Deciding whether to formulate an SMSF can be a complex decision. While SMSFs offer possible benefits such as flexible investment strategies and increased control over your retirement savings, they also require significant commitment. Consider factors like your investment knowledge, time availability, and the complexity of your portfolio before making a decision. It's recommended to speak with from a qualified financial advisor to evaluate if an SMSF is the appropriate solution for your individual circumstances.
